Transaction ddb7056b907aff093b0d4ecd6683bb4364457102f08bbcd04e948e04bfb577b9
1 Input
1 Output
-
ddb7056b907aff093b0d4ecd6683bb4364457102f08bbcd04e948e04bfb577b9:0
- value
- 50958244
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a98905294de6849f2d9ddf65f09b9a0d2fed35bc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GTRLkL8JBgBsxGoCLnHS1XbG4vLMoNXHV